Your Fukushima Vacation

Let our vacation packages to Fukushima inspire your next great adventure. You'll find a lot to like about this exciting city, starting with the neighborhood of Hirasawa, which is good for golfing and camping. Any trip to Fukushima needs a well-thought-out itinerary. Fill yours with big-name attractions like Fukushima Checkpoint Site, Yamamura Daikan Yashiki and Road Station Kisofukushima.
